New @deepseek-ai/dsh-invariants plugin (pure listeners, off in prod) asserts the event taxonomy at runtime — seq monotonicity, turn/step nesting, a tool/result needs a prior tool/call (NOT the converse), legal agent/status transitions — and deep-freezes logged event data so mutating history throws. Seeded sessions are checked + frozen on session/created. The real RFC 008 fix is always-on: deriveMessages now structured-clones the content it emits, so the loop's sanctioned request/adapter mutation can no longer reach back and rewrite the append-only log. The pervasive DeepReadonly<T> type flip is rejected (compile-only, high-noise, castable) — recorded in ADR 0012, which folds in RFC 008. Wired into both demos.
